Transaction 84b176138f56d799dda845de794c6112c9fc088f44ddf6610d68262a54b2a291
1 Input
1 Output
-
84b176138f56d799dda845de794c6112c9fc088f44ddf6610d68262a54b2a291:0
- value
- 208003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8554c6c6dd4bd6b56c65d2b722d03a2cf8a2c28a OP_EQUAL
- address
- 3Dr1MRst25T1ymWofPVMpPuvcFDqeAQTSt